Background

Dr. Khodadad Namiranian is a triple board-certified physician specializing in Pain Medicine (American Board of Anesthesiology), Anesthesiology (American Board of Anesthesiology), and Addiction Medicine (American Board of Preventive Medicine)He also holds a certification in Headache MedicineDr. Namiranian completed his fellowship training in Interventional Pain Management at the prestigious Cleveland Clinic in OhioBeyond his medical degree from Tehran University of Medical Sciences, he also holds a Ph.D. from Baylor College of MedicineDr. Namiranian has held faculty positions at both the California Health Sciences University and the University of Maryland School of Medicine and is a Qualified Medical Examiner (QME) with the California Division of Workers’ CompensationHis professional contributions include over 30 peer-reviewed journal articles and a book chapter.
